03:09James, I kind of wanted you to weigh in on this.
03:11So specifically talking to Mitch Payton, team owner at Pro Circuit Kawasaki,
03:15he said it was clutch stuff they've been working on.
03:17Garrett Marchbank said he had gone through about eight different clutches,
03:19and they were trying to figure out a better feel for the guys out the gate.
03:22This is obviously the newer version of the bike.
03:25They said everywhere else on the track they've been getting great results,
03:27but those starts were holding them back.
03:29So if you can just kind of explain what that means to a rider
03:31to have the right feel for the clutch out of the gate.
03:34Yeah, I mean, working on the clutches for them to initially get that jump
03:38because no matter how fast your motorcycle is,
03:40if you don't get the first three or four feet out of the gate,
03:43it's not going to matter.
03:44So I think those guys understand that they've got to get the jump,
03:48and to me this second moto I don't think has anything to do with the clutch
03:51because they obviously struggled that first moto.
03:53I think the gate flinched.
03:55A lot of guys are going, and it looks like so far Seth Handmaker
03:58was the one guy who didn't get caught off guard.
04:01But I like what Mitch is doing.
04:02They know they have the power.
04:04They've got to be able to get that jump.
04:06Otherwise they get closed off, and it's just a waste of time at that point.

26:16This is Harrop.
26:17He's been so good, though,
26:19and it's reflected
26:20in the points.
26:21He's actually
26:21fifth in the standings
26:23in what is just a summer
26:24in the United States.
26:25He'll go back
26:26to MXGP.
26:28Was supposed to race
26:29to 450 for triumph
26:30in Europe this year,
26:31but the bike wasn't ready.
26:32So they said,
26:34well, honor your deal.
26:35You could be a test rider
26:36and then someone
26:36came up with the idea
26:37of, well,
26:38why don't you just
26:38go to America?
26:39You can ride a 250 there.
26:40Because in Europe,
26:41they have a rule
26:41in MXGP.
26:42Once you turn 23,
26:44you're not allowed
26:44to race a 250 anymore.
26:46So that's why
26:47he was a man
26:47without a spot.
26:49And, boy,
26:49has it worked out well.
